What is a sunroof shade slider?

A sunroof shade slider is a thin, plastic panel that fits into the frame of a sunroof, and is used to slide the sunroof open and closed.

What are the benefits of having a sunroof shade slider?

Having a sunroof shade slider provides several benefits, including:

  1. Improving the overall air circulation in your vehicle;
  2. Enhancing the aesthetic of your vehicle;
  3. Offering convenience when opening and closing your sunroof.


How do I know if my sunroof shade slider is faulty?

If your sunroof shade slider is faulty, you may experience problems such as:

  1. Difficulty in opening and closing the sunroof;
  2. Uneven movement when opening and closing the sunroof;
  3. Creaking or grinding noises when opening and closing the sunroof.


Can a faulty sunroof shade slider cause damage?

Yes, a faulty sunroof shade slider can cause damage to the frame of the sunroof, as well as to the interior and exterior of the vehicle.

How do I replace a sunroof shade slider?

Replacing a sunroof shade slider is a relatively simple process, involving the following steps:

  1. Remove the old slider by unscrewing the screws that hold it in place;
  2. Install the new slider by screwing it into place;
  3. Test the new slider to ensure it is properly secured and functioning correctly.
